Does anyone know how to calculate the Ripple Voltage on a half-wave rectifier circuit and on a full-wave?
I found the following formulas but when I compare them with what I get on the oscilloscope, the difference is huge!
Ripple (half-wave)= 4,5 x I(mA)/C( μ F)
Ripple (full-wave)= 1,7 x I(mA)/C( μ F)
